"Welcome to the All-American Sawtelle Stampede in beautiful Island Park, Idaho!"

The Island Park Area Chamber of Commerce founded the Sawtelle Stampede in July, 1997 to provide a fun, healthy and family-oriented event on the July 4th weekend.  Our event is for everyone.  Individual walkers, joggers and the elite runner.  We encourage and offer discounts for teams of families, friends, clubs and organizations.

Set for Saturday, July 3, 2010, the Stampede starts at 9:00 a.m.  Register for the Half Marathon run, 10k run, 5k walk/run or 1k kid's walk/run events. The course takes us on dirt forest service roads and trails through the scenic Caribou-Targhee National Forest. With plenty of shade, a rambling stream, breathtaking scenery, enthusiastic and upbeat water stations, this course is truly one of a kind.

We kick off our morning with a Patriotic Tribute.  Idaho Liquid Sound provides the stage and energetic music.  A welcoming and morning innovation, our nation's colors are presented by our local Boy Scout Troop, our National Anthem is performed live by one of Island Park's very own vocalists.  A rendition that should not be missed.  All this with the spectacular Sawtell Mountain as the backdrop.

The event is a fundraiser for the Island Park Non-Motorized Trail Project. This activity is under permit with the Caribou-Targhee National Forest.  All participants will be contributing to the development of the recreational trail system.  Our vision is to have a non-motorized trail from Henry's Lake to Harriman State Park.  We are joining together with the United States Forest Service and Island Park Gem Community Team to make this vision a reality.  In fact, this summer we are very excited that the first section along the Box Canyon Trail will be completed.
